Understanding Industrial Chemical Applications
Industrial chemical applications refer to the use of various chemical substances in manufacturing processes to achieve specific outcomes. These chemicals can serve multiple purposes such as cleaning, coating, catalysing reactions, or even acting as raw materials. Their versatility makes them indispensable in industries ranging from agriculture to electronics.
For example, in the production of plastics, chemicals like polymer additives improve durability and flexibility. In metal manufacturing, chemicals are used for surface treatment to prevent corrosion and enhance strength. The right chemical application not only improves product quality but also reduces waste and energy consumption.

Agriculture
In agriculture, chemicals such as fertilizers, pesticides, and herbicides are essential for boosting crop yields and protecting plants from pests and diseases. Fertilizers supply vital nutrients like nitrogen, phosphorus, and potassium, which are crucial for plant growth. Pesticides and herbicides help control unwanted insects and weeds, ensuring healthier crops.

Manufacturing and Processing
In manufacturing, chemicals are used for:
Surface treatment: Coatings and paints protect metals and other materials from corrosion and wear.
Catalysts: Chemicals that speed up reactions in processes like polymerisation and refining.
Cleaning agents: Industrial solvents and detergents remove contaminants from machinery and products.
Adhesives and sealants: Chemicals that bond materials together or seal joints to prevent leaks.
For instance, in the automotive industry, industrial chemicals are used to coat car parts, improving their resistance to rust and wear. In electronics manufacturing, chemicals help in etching circuit boards and cleaning components.
Textiles and Apparel
The textile industry relies heavily on chemicals for dyeing, printing, and finishing fabrics. Chemicals improve colour fastness, texture, and durability of textiles. They also help in water and stain resistance treatments, making fabrics more functional and appealing.
Construction
Chemical additives in construction materials like concrete and asphalt improve strength, durability, and workability. Waterproofing agents and sealants protect buildings from moisture damage. These chemicals ensure that structures last longer and require less maintenance.

How Industrial Chemicals Enhance Manufacturing Efficiency
Efficiency is a top priority in modern manufacturing. Industrial chemicals contribute significantly to this by:
Reducing processing time: Catalysts and accelerators speed up chemical reactions.
Lowering energy consumption: Some chemicals enable processes to occur at lower temperatures or pressures.
Minimising waste: Chemicals that improve yield reduce raw material wastage.
Improving product consistency: Additives ensure uniform quality across production batches.
For example, in the production of plastics, chemical additives can reduce cycle times in moulding processes. In metal finishing, chemical baths clean and prepare surfaces faster than mechanical methods.
By integrating these chemical solutions, manufacturers can optimise their operations, reduce costs, and increase output without compromising quality.
